Community spruces up Southside school landscape

October 06, 2012 @ 12:00 AM

HUNTINGTON -- Volunteers from a local church joined Southside residents and students and staff from Southside Elementary School to help with landscaping at the school during a Saturday in September.

The group of more than dozen people helped spread mulch, pull weeds and plant bushes and shrubbery around the school. Twenty-two came from Missio Dei Church.

Parents and residents helped raise $1,100 for the landscaping needs, while Blatt's Greenhouse in Lavalette and Lowe's provided discounts for the project. And a dump truck full of mulch was donated by a parent.
